Paige Bueckers’ birthday includes throwing dimes at Cowboys game

Dallas Wings star Paige Bueckers just finished her rookie season in the WNBA but, if the Dallas Cowboys game on Sunday is any indication, she can also spin it.

Bueckers, who is celebrating her 24th birthday Monday, attended the Cowboys game against the Washington Commanders at AT&T Stadium in Arlington, Texas. It’s the third in a string of local games Bueckers has been to, including a Dallas Mavericks preseason game and Oklahoma-Texas football.

The WNBA Rookie of the Year signed autographs for fans from the front row of the end zone at the Cowboys game. Someone handed Bueckers a football and asked her to throw it to him. She told the little boy to go out for a pass. He didn’t go out far enough for her liking and she let him know with a 20-yard dart to another kid on the field. The second kid brought the ball back and she hit him with another long pass.

Bueckers also hooked up with another No. 5, Commanders quarterback Jayden Daniels, to exchange jerseys. Daniels was injured during the game, tweaking his groin. If the Commanders are looking for a backup, maybe they should give Bueckers a call.
